Toro Harnecker

In 1998, the Toro Harnecker family, iconic producers of glass bottles for the Chilean wine industry, decided to realize the dream of using their bottles to bottle their own wine.

They decided that the hills of Chocalán, in the coastal part of the Maipo Valley, were perfect for producing high quality wines.

SUSTAINABILITY

We are committed to the SUSTAINABLE AND ENVIRONMENTALLY RESPONSIBLE DEVELOPMENT of our wines and we have the Sustainability Certificate granted by Wines of Chile through its R&D Consortium.

Since 2006 we have been certified to ISO 9001 - QUALITY and 14001 - ENVIRONMENTAL standards, respectively, and in 2007 we obtained our certificate of compliance with the CLEAN PRODUCTION AGREEMENT (APL), which was validated by different governmental agencies in the country, such as: Undersecretary of Public Health, Superintendence of Sanitary Services, National Environmental Commission and the Agriculture and Livestock Service.
